Transaction 134dbce0886de153eb879fc12445e367e16cafb37ca9beb876da1647e0ec6819

2 Input
2 Outputs
  • 134dbce0886de153eb879fc12445e367e16cafb37ca9beb876da1647e0ec6819:0
  • value  917121
    address  3BABUpxo5RivZJbBuHrpaFxfSdnXeZ9XAp
  • 134dbce0886de153eb879fc12445e367e16cafb37ca9beb876da1647e0ec6819:1
  • value  1106084
    address  35f3bi2JrCgGvgeXufRxRsbVpc8KjPpHn7